Naming of "Watson & Associates Literacy Center" honors generosity of founder and associates
CSSB News, August 2nd, 2006

On July 19, 2006, the California State University, San Bernardino Board of Trustees voted to officially name the Cal State San Bernardino literacy center in honor of Watson and Associates, honoring the company’s generosity in establishing and funding$1 million toward the center.

San Bernardino looks at new urban projects
November 6th, 2005

CSUSB professor Sant Khalsa is quoted in The Press-Enterprise about two planned use projects in the city of San Bernardino to combine homes, offices, shops and artists' studios in the same neighborhood, emphasizing walking instead of driving. One of the projects, called the Colony, is part of J. R. Watson & Associates Development Corporation University Park subdivision at University and Northpark boulevards that would have the construction of 22 units, each with upstairs living space and a ground floor suitable for art studios or offices. Khalsa consulted with Watson as it designed the project.

Regency At University Park Opened In San Bernardino
LA Times - November 20, 2004

December will mark the preview opening of Regency at University Park, a collection of 90 new luxury detached homes on quarter-acre lots adjacent to California State University San Bernardino, according to the Corona-based Inland Empire division of Richmond American Homes. The Regency property is located northwest of the intersection of University Parkway and Northpark Boulevard.
